Output 4aa24708b33be81c0c41c253e65089f92170393957edfd1ff0a45f83315c6c71:23

value
892000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 242f72345a77b2ac7b5e3cc61c9f5dccd6d14981 OP_EQUAL
address
34zM64d4F9pYuLxGndbBKxFF73AAbmwH41
transaction
4aa24708b33be81c0c41c253e65089f92170393957edfd1ff0a45f83315c6c71